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75 177174083 4988 055269980
3408648 1526585 22445661148
3408648 1526585 22445661148
949736 868 839306848
All about undefined
Interested in learning more?
3408648 1526585 22445661148
949736 868 839306848
See more
4691109264 198 6090
702 1748 101 1547664520 695303949
See more
7444512666 620651 871
85997 946355 4211652 45186
See more